Che Guevara, born Ernesto Guevara de la Serna on June 14, 1928, in Argentina, was a Marxist revolutionary and key figure of the Cuban Revolution led by Fidel Castro. Emerging as a symbol of anti-imperialism and rebellion, Che became known for his guerrilla warfare tactics and passionate advocacy for socialist principles. His iconic image, captured by photographer Alberto Korda, adorns countless posters and t-shirts worldwide, symbolizing youthful idealism and defiance against oppression.
Che’s journey as a revolutionary began with his motorbike trip across South America, which exposed him to the poverty and injustices faced by the continent’s people. This experience fueled his desire to combat social inequality and class struggle. Joining forces with Castro, Che played a crucial role in overthrowing the U.S.-backed Batista regime in Cuba in 1959. He held various positions in the Cuban government, including heading the National Bank and Ministry of Industries, where he implemented land reforms and promoted industrialization.

Beyond Cuba, Che continued his revolutionary efforts by supporting insurgencies in other Latin American countries, Africa, and even the Congo. He believed in the global struggle against imperialism and capitalism, advocating for armed struggle as a means to achieve revolutionary change. Che’s writings, such as “Guerilla Warfare” and “The Motorcycle Diaries,” offer insights into his revolutionary ideology and tactics.

Che Guevara’s legacy remains complex, with passionate supporters hailing him as a hero of the oppressed and fierce critic of capitalist exploitation. However, his critics point to his roles in summary executions and harsh tactics during the Cuban Revolution as evidence of his authoritarian tendencies. Despite his death in Bolivia in 1967, Che’s revolutionary spirit lives on, inspiring activists and revolutionaries globally to challenge injustice and fight for a more equitable world.
